A Closer Look at 24/7 HVAC Repair

When the AC stops in a Wesley Chapel heat wave, the house can turn uncomfortable fast. When the heating system quits on a cold night, even a short chill can make the home feel out of balance. This area’s long cooling season and sudden weather swings make urgent repairs a real need. Fast service helps restore comfort and keep the system from getting worse.

Emergency service starts with a quick safety check and a focused diagnosis of the failed system. The technician looks at power, airflow, drain issues, controls, refrigerant, and moving parts so the root cause is clear. For a heating system problem, the visit may also include testing safety devices, backup heat, or ignition parts if the setup uses them. Once the fault is found, the technician explains the repair path before starting work.

After the repair, the system should run more normally once the bad part is replaced or reset and the system is tested again. Some emergency fixes solve the issue right away, while others need a follow-up if a larger problem sits underneath. You can help by watching for new leaks, noise, or weak airflow after the visit. The cost of emergency HVAC repair in Wesley Chapel depends on the failed part, the time needed to diagnose it, and whether the issue affects cooling, heating, or both. A quick electrical fix may cost less labor than a compressor, motor, or control problem. Night, weekend, or severe-weather calls can also change the total work involved. A clear diagnosis helps you understand the repair before any work starts.
A price for emergency HVAC repair in Wesley Chapel should start with a focused visit that checks the system and finds the cause of the breakdown. The technician should tell you whether the quote includes diagnosis, parts, labor, and testing before the repair begins. If the problem is urgent, the visit may move fast, but the pricing should still be explained in plain language. That gives you a clear path forward.
Before the emergency HVAC visit in Wesley Chapel, turn off the system if it is making a loud noise, leaking water, or smelling burnt. Clear access to the indoor and outdoor units and note what changed before the failure. The visit length depends on the problem, but the technician will test the system, find the fault, and explain the repair steps. That helps the work move faster and safer.
In many cases, the system can work again the same day if the problem is a failed part, a tripped safety device, or a blocked drain. If the repair needs a special part or deeper troubleshooting, it can take longer. In Wesley Chapel, the goal is to get cooling or heat back before the house becomes harder to live in. The technician should test the system before finishing the visit.
Emergency repair makes sense when the system has a single fault and the rest of the unit still has good life left. Replacement may be the better choice if the system is old, fails often, or has major damage that keeps the home at risk. In Wesley Chapel, long cooling seasons can make repeated emergency calls a sign that replacement may save more trouble later. A technician can help compare both paths.
You can safely check the thermostat, breaker, and air filter, but deeper emergency HVAC repair should be left to a pro. Electrical parts, refrigerant, and safety controls can make the issue worse if you guess wrong. In Wesley Chapel, attic equipment and tight utility spaces can add more risk. A trained technician can diagnose the system safely and avoid extra damage.
If the same problem comes back, the original repair may have treated only one part of a larger issue. A clogged drain, weak airflow, worn control part, or deeper electrical fault can all cause repeat trouble in Wesley Chapel homes. The next step is a full system check so the root cause gets found. That helps reduce repeat failures and restore dependable operation.
You likely need emergency HVAC repair if the system is blowing hot air, leaking water, making sharp noises, or refusing to start during extreme weather. In Wesley Chapel, a no-cool call in summer or a no-heat call during a cold snap can become urgent fast. A regular service call fits smaller issues that do not leave the home uncomfortable right away.
